Water Pump: Removal
- Disconnect battery ground cable
- Lift-up the vehicle.
- Remove under cover.
- Drain engine coolant completely.
Refer to DRAINING OF ENGINE COOLANT .
- Disconnect connectors from radiator main fan (A) and sub fan (B) motors.
- Remove bolt which installs water by-pass pipe of oil cooler onto oil pump. (AT vehicles only)
- Disconnect radiator outlet hose (A) and heater hose (B) from water pump.
- Disconnect water by-pass hose (C). (AT vehicles only)
- Lower the vehicle.
- Disconnect over flow hose.
- Remove reservoir tank
- Remove radiator main fan and sub fan assemblies. Refer to RADIATOR MAIN FAN AND FAN MOTOR and RADIATOR SUB FAN AND FAN MOTOR .
- Remove V-belts. Refer to V-BELT .
- Remove timing belt. Refer to TIMING BELT ASSEMBLY .
- Remove automatic belt tension adjuster.
- Remove belt idler No. 2.
- Remove camshaft position sensor. Refer to CAMSHAFT POSITION SENSOR .
- Remove left-hand camshaft sprocket by using ST.
ST 499207100: CAMSHAFT SPROCKET WRENCH
- Remove tensioner bracket.
- Remove left-hand belt cover No. 2.
- Remove water pump.
